Marvin (Tyke) Paulson, 61, of Missoula passed away on Friday May 2, 2025, at Community Medical Center, from a heart attack.
He was born December 24, 1963 to Marvin B. and Ramona R. Paulson, in Fairview Montana. As a child he lived with his two brothers and Mom in Sidney Montana. He attended Sidney Public Schools and made many lifelong friendships.
On September 13, 1986, he married Tina Iken in Sidney, and they moved to Missoula to further their education at the University of Montana.
He worked in IT at the University of Montana for Continuing Education and Online Learning for over 20 years, and he loved every minute of it.
Whatever he did, he did it with his whole heart. He loved working on cars, playing pool, wood working, and rebuilding computers. He was happy to share his research and knowledge with all.
He loved his wife Tina and their three children Elizabeth (Lyssa), Derrick, and Sarah. He wrote many letters to his Mom about how much he enjoyed being a Dad to Lyssa and Derrick when they were little. He tried to attend all their many activities and became a passionate cheer Dad for Sarah.
He had a mischievous sense of humor and a ready smile. He made new friends everywhere he went all his life.
Tyke is survived by his wife Tina and their three children Elizabeth Ryan (Marc), Derrick Paulson (Lauren), and Sarah Paulson (Dylan Goforth). He is also survived by his older brother Nathan Paulson (Yvette) and daughter Shandee, younger brother Dale Berntson (Clara Mae) and his children Katie and Kyle, his aunts Hurleyn Hanson and Zeila Sakshaug, and numerous cousins. He is also survived by his mother-in-law Elizabeth Iken and sister in-law Kelly Feldman (Kirby).
He was preceded in death by his parents and his father-in-law, John Iken.
